Event overview

The Lancaster Bomber Run takes place in Walton on Thames, Surrey at the Xcel SPORTS HUB Stadium, Waterside Drive, KT12 2JG. It is a timed, multi-distance event held on Friday 6 November 2026. The organiser allows flexible start arrangements within a one-hour window and a maximum event duration of seven hours. Places are strictly limited.

Course and distances

The course is an out-and-back along the river Thames on off-road riverside towpath. The surface is trail and the overall route has no elevation gain or loss, making it flat.

Minimum distance is one lap (3.28 miles) or as far as a participant can go within the seven-hour limit. Runners may complete as many laps as they choose.

Entry, medals and services

Entry fees listed for the event include an affiliated rate of £37.95 and an unattached rate of £39.95. A no-medal entry option is offered at a flat £20. For 2026 the finishers' medal is presented in an antique silver finish. The event provides aid stations, same-day results, athlete profiles, digital BIBs and digital finishers' certificates.
